We're using VisAD for data visualisation (math functions ...). So we
open several differents JFrame with one 3d-display in each frame.

On windows 95 an 98 i have some strange behaviour :

I open without problem five (for example) windows and when i open one
more window there are two display in it ! i mean that the display of one
of the first five windows is now in the new window (and it has
disappeared from its original window) !! one display is upon the other
and i see them alternatively when i move the visualisation with my
mouse.

What i noticed is that it happens when i open the windows at the same
place on the screen (for instance by opening 6 windows at the same time)
... if i open them one by one and i iconify each window before opening
another the problem doesn't appear !!!

I don't know if i'm clear but i really don't understand what's
happening. I used the last VisAD release but it doesn't change anything.

I use jdk 1.3.1 and java 3d 1.1.2 ...

I tried to use higher release of java 3d (> 1.2) but it's worse : i can
open five windows with the good display and for new windows the display
doesn't even appear.

This problem doesn't occure on windows NT platform  ...
